Well, it’s hard to know what your behavior has been in years past. But when I come home I run my glasses under the sink and dry them before I clean the lens with a cloth. If I don’t, I could have dust or sand on the lens which will scratch the lenses up bad.

I learned that the hard way with a lot of 24 k lenses 🙃
 
Pretty much what he said, some of the older lenses I’ve noticed can take a bit more of a beating, old m frames, razorblades, eyeshades, the original wire frames.

I still have blade lenses that have been through hell from the 80s tjat look better than my 2014 reissues
